Going forward, all plugin flags must be declared in the manifest before init, and the framework will reject late registrations with an explicit error rather than a silent fallback. We ask all external authors to migrate by the next SDK release. The manifest schema, migration steps, and validation tool are documented on the page below.

wiki page, tahaf-tajog: https://jira.ordindyn.corp/pipeline

Ticket: Stale prices after catalog edits in Shelfwright

When a merchant updates a product in Shelfwright, the catalog cache for that SKU isn't invalidated on the read replicas — only the primary region flushes. Shoppers in the Farrow region see stale prices for up to 40 minutes. Proposed fix: publish invalidation events to the fanout topic instead of the direct cache call, so all regions subscribe. Reviewer, please check the event ordering assumptions in the consumer. The reproduction build's token follows below.

pipeline stamp: htk21_86b657ac0aa916a9af17f

To the board: Q3 gross margin slipped 2.1 points, driven by input costs at the Derrowfield plant and discounting in the Lanthorn product line. Freight recovery improved but not enough. Actions: renegotiate two supplier contracts, trim low-margin SKUs, tighten discount approvals above 10%. Finance will model a price increase for January. No change to full-year guidance yet; we reassess after October close. Questions to the CFO before Thursday's session. The confidential statement of business plans follows immediately below.

board note of bawep-tajef: Queniusek Systems plans to raise the Quenvan list price by 53.1 percent in March. The pricing group signed off on a budget of $176.4 million for Project Drueth. The renewal with Casionix Partners closes at $142.5 million a year, 8.3 percent below the last contract. Project Fraax slips by six weeks because of the tooling delay.

Subject: Handover — LintScribe shift

Hey, quick handover before I log off. LintScribe has been flagging false positives on the changelog templates since Tuesday's rule update — I muted rule DL-40 on the release branch so the pipeline stays green. The Fernwood team owns the rule pack and promised a fix by Thursday. Nothing else is burning. If the fix slips past the release cut, raise it with the tooling rotation directly.

billing contact of yawip-yadup = druath.casdor@nelvrolabs.internal